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Overgrowth syndromes are rare genetic disorders defined by tissue hypertrophy that can be either localized or generalized, affecting both latitudinal and longitudinal growth. The genes involved in overgrowth syndromes are not well characterized but mostly concern the PIK3CA/AKT/mTOR pathway, a major actor of cell growth and proliferation. The mutations are not inherited but occurs during embryogenesis leading to somatic mosaicism. Owing to the variability of the clinical presentation, their exact prevalence is yet unknown. In order to answer this question, the investigators team create here the first French national registry on overgrowth syndromes.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Affiliated to the French healthcare insurance system.
2. Pediatric and adult patients
3. Clinical diagnosis of overgrowth syndrome
4. Written informed consent from adult patients and from both parents of pediatric patients.

Exclusion Criteria

1. Person subject to a judicial safeguard measure
2. Inability to give informed consent
